We are seeking a highly skilled engineer to design, build, and operate large-scale, cloud-native systems that power Ford’s connected vehicle capabilities. In this role, you will design and support mission-critical cloud platform components, own services that directly impact customer experiences, and help shape the technical direction of platforms operating at extreme scale. You will balance strong data-driven decision-making with the ability to move forward effectively when information is incomplete.

Responsibilities

Engineering & System Design

  • Design, develop, maintain, and support multiple mission-critical cloud platform components that enable Ford’s connected vehicle ecosystem.
  • Own end-to-end delivery of software services powering critical customer experiences, as well as the platform infrastructure that supports them.
  • Design, develop, and operate high-performance, cloud-based and microservices-driven platforms at scale.
  • Build resilient backend services using technologies such as Java, Spring Boot, Kafka, PostgreSQL, gRPC, REST, and Kubernetes.
  • Develop and deploy services on AWS and/or GCP, leveraging managed services.

Cloud, DevOps & Delivery Excellence

  • Implement and maintain robust CI/CD pipelines with a strong focus on security, reliability, and efficiency.
  • Apply TDD and DevOps best practices using tools such as Jenkins, ArgoCD, SonarQube, Fossa, and GitHub.
  • Champion automation and operational consistency across environments.
